Police Probing Possible Mistreatment of Dog

Suffolk County Crime Stoppers and Suffolk County Police Second Precinct Crime Section officers are seeking a male wanted for questioning regarding an incident during which a dog was possibly mistreated at the Huntington High School parking lot.

The incident occurred Feb. 12 at approximately 9 p.m.

Suffolk County Crime Stoppers offers a cash reward for information that leads to an arrest.
